WooCommerce Empty Cart Issue with Stripe Plugin

This is an internal “note to self”, I didn’t get to the bottom of the issue, the solution is a workaround that solved my problem.

Solution

  • Go to WooCommerce –> Settings, select “Products” tab
  • Check the “Redirect to the cart page after successful addition” checkbox

Background

WooCommerce is set up with products synced from both Printful and Printify. Stripe is the payment processor (via Stripe Payments For WooCommerce by Checkout Plugins). So far I have only had products through the POD providers (Printful and Printify), and everything was working as expected.

The issue started when I added my own product that I was planning to fulfill myself.

Steps to Reproduce

  1. Add a product to the cart
  2. Go to the cart
  3. The product is not in the cart, “Your cart is currently empty” message is displayed

Observations

  • Deactivating the Stripe plugin fixes the issue – I’m able to see the product in the cart, so it seems that there is a connection to the Stripe plugin.
  • Weird that it works with the POD products but not a regular product created in WooCommerce.
